Hi folks,

I'm finding something strange when travelling westbound on the M3, past SPECS 29806. The M3 goes national speed limit following this camera, but the all clear isn't given by CamerAlert and the average speed indicator remains.

Any ideas?

There is another area of SPECS cameras further west, but the alert isn't given for a fair while after the national speed limit zone starts.

29806 is marked up as a Middle Camera, so it won't trigger the all clear. Trouble is, those M3 specs have come and gone like the wind, here today, moved up the road tomorrow, not in use today, taking your cash yesterday, they can't seem to make their minds up, no wonder we get them as middle instead of end! We have more submissions awaiting verification in that area already. Your solution in the meantime is to tap that icon to turn off average speed when you've passed it. (And report a change on the camera submission page).
